.two-column-content {
  padding: 4.8rem 0;
}
@media only screen and (min-width: 992px) {
  .two-column-content {
    padding: 10rem 0;
  }
}
@media only screen and (max-width: 992px) {
  .two-column-content .flex-row-mobile {
    flex-direction: column-reverse !important;
  }
}
.two-column-content .flex-row-mobile figure {
  margin-bottom: 2.4rem;
}
@media only screen and (min-width: 992px) {
  .two-column-content .flex-row-mobile figure {
    margin-bottom: 0;
  }
}
.two-column-content.advocacy-content {
  padding: 4.8rem 0 0;
}
.two-column-content.making-waves-contentimg .main-content {
  max-width: 100%;
}
@media screen and (min-width: 992px) {
  .two-column-content.making-waves-contentimg .main-content {
    max-width: 59.3rem;
  }
}
.two-column-content.making-waves-contentimg figure {
  max-width: 100%;
}
@media screen and (min-width: 992px) {
  .two-column-content.making-waves-contentimg figure {
    max-width: 55.8rem;
  }
}
.two-column-content .main-content {
  max-width: 100%;
}
@media only screen and (min-width: 992px) {
  .two-column-content .main-content {
    max-width: 55rem;
  }
}
.two-column-content .main-content p {
  margin-bottom: 4.8rem;
}
@media only screen and (min-width: 992px) {
  .two-column-content .main-content p {
    margin-bottom: 0;
  }
}
.two-column-content .main-content h4 {
  color: var(--Primary-Dark-Magenta);
  margin-bottom: 0.8rem;
}
.two-column-content .main-content h2 {
  margin-bottom: 2.4rem;
}
.two-column-content .white-background-content {
  border-radius: 1rem;
  background: var(--Neutral-White);
  padding: 3.2rem 2.4rem;
  margin: 0;
  background-color: white;
}
@media only screen and (min-width: 992px) {
  .two-column-content .white-background-content {
    padding: 6.4rem;
  }
}
.two-column-content .white-background-content h3 {
  margin-bottom: 2.4rem;
}
.two-column-content .white-background-content p {
  margin-bottom: 2.4rem;
}
.two-column-content .white-background-content ul {
  margin-bottom: 2.4rem;
}
.two-column-content .white-background-content ul li {
  font-weight: 400;
  margin-bottom: 1rem;
  font-size: var(--paragraph);
  line-height: 150%;
}
.two-column-content .white-background-content ul li:last-child {
  margin-bottom: 0;
}
.two-column-content .content-buttons {
  display: flex;
  align-items: center;
  gap: 1.6rem;
  justify-content: flex-start;
  margin-bottom: 3.2rem;
}
@media only screen and (min-width: 992px) {
  .two-column-content .content-buttons {
    margin-bottom: 0;
  }
}
.two-column-content figure {
  margin: 0;
}
@media only screen and (max-width: 992px) {
  .two-column-content figure.text-end {
    text-align: left !important;
  }
}
.two-column-content figure img {
  border-radius: 10px;
}
.two-column-content .hs-8 h2 {
  margin-bottom: 0.8rem;
}
.two-column-content .hs-8 h4 {
  margin-bottom: 0.8rem;
}
.two-column-content .hs-24 h1 {
  margin-bottom: 2.4rem;
}
.two-column-content .hs-24 h3 {
  margin-bottom: 2.4rem;
}
.two-column-content .hs-32 h2 {
  margin-bottom: 2rem;
}
.two-column-content .hs-48 h1 {
  margin-bottom: 4.8rem;
}
.two-column-content .hs-48 h2 {
  margin-bottom: 0.8rem;
}
.two-column-content .hs-48 p {
  margin-bottom: 4.8rem;
}
.two-column-content .hs-48 p:last-child {
  margin-bottom: 0;
}
.two-column-content .hs-90 h2 {
  margin-bottom: 3.2rem;
}
@media only screen and (min-width: 992px) {
  .two-column-content .hs-90 h2 {
    margin-bottom: 9rem;
  }
}
.two-column-content .hs-90 p {
  margin-bottom: 2.4rem;
}

@media only screen and (max-width: 992px) {
  .spacer-48 {
    height: 4.8rem !important;
  }
  .p-48 {
    padding: 4.8rem 0;
  }
  .p-64 {
    padding: 6.4rem 0;
  }
  .p-32 {
    padding: 3.2rem 0 1.8rem;
  }
  .pb-t-0 {
    padding: 6.4rem 0 0 0;
  }
}/*# sourceMappingURL=style.css.map */